    Retail parks outperform high street and shopping centres

    Retail parks showed a growth in footfall in July, with high streets and shopping centres suffering a decrease, figures from retail footfall analysts Springboard show. Footfall on the high streets fell by 2.1% which shopping centres showed a 1.3% decline. Retail parks saw a 1.7% increase. July was the fourth…

    CMJโ€™s CEO Willie Hamilton steps down

    Willie Hamilton, CEO of Company of Master Jewellers (CMJ), has announced his departure from the role after 10 years. The CMJ is a buying group for independent retailers of watches and jewellery in the UK and Ireland and currently has over 150 members. Michael Aldridge, chairman of CMJ, said: โ€œWillie…
